Transaction 203991126dbeef0969ddbdb60d80e69c99bcde372833bc5e5647e30312a5329e

2 Input
2 Outputs
  • 203991126dbeef0969ddbdb60d80e69c99bcde372833bc5e5647e30312a5329e:0
  • value  17856581
    address  bc1qku7ztcc7jmz4d26qvzhu37vuj73kksu5zpkkly
  • 203991126dbeef0969ddbdb60d80e69c99bcde372833bc5e5647e30312a5329e:1
  • value  2499974000
    address  1NkrfpNGzgwfXqdWxdQmK13gGGYNdnrJ4g